Drivers fill up on soft tyres for Italian GP

Pirelli has confirmed the compound selections for each driver for the Italian Grand Prix next month. The red-walled soft tyre is the favourite by far, with some drivers selecting as many as ten sets. Red Bull's Max Verstappen is amongst those, with the Dutchman taking just one mandatory set of the white hard tyre and two of the yellow medium. The remaining front-runners have all opted for eight sets of the soft, though differ slightly in their remaining sets with Mercedes' Lewis Hamilton and Valtteri Bottas taking three and four sets of the medium respectively, which is mirrored by Ferrari's Sebastian Vettel and Charles Leclerc.
